Somalia Holds Trade Forum to Raise Export Quality, Import Standards

Storyline:Business

GOOBJOOG NEWS | MOGADISHU: The Ministry of Commerce on Monday opened the Second National Quality Infrastructure Forum in Mogadishu, a two-day meeting aimed at strengthening exports and tightening import standards.

Commerce Minister Mahmud Ahmed Aden said the initiative would help Somalia expand its participation in regional and global trade by ensuring safe, high-quality goods in domestic and export markets.

The forum brought together policymakers, private sector leaders, development partners and regulators, who discussed certification systems and the role of quality standards in unlocking new export opportunities for Somali businesses.
